Purpose
This workshop is intended primarily for municipal governments with wet weather management responsibilities, i.e., stormwater, combined sewer overflows, sanitary sewer overflows and nonpoint source runoff. The workshop will focus on how these programs can be effectively managed using green infrastructure technologies and approaches.
Agenda Topics
- The benefits of green infrastructure practices, including:
- Reduced and delayed stormwater runoff
- Runoff enhanced groundwater recharge
- Stormwater pollutant reductions
- Increased land values
- Construction Savings
- Operation and maintenance
- Retrofitting green infrastructure practices
- Case study of green infrastructure design and construction
- Local incentives for green infrastructure
- Relevant municipal codes and ordinances work session
The workshop will include the opportunity for discussions with national experts, municipal operators, and state and federal regulators on the many facets of implementing a green infrastructure program.
